In this study, the influence of various concentrations of molybdate (MoO42-) on critical pitting temperature (CPT) of duplex stainless steel 2205 (DSS 2205) in 0.1 M NaCl solution has been investigated by employing potentiodynamic and potentiostatic CPT measurements methods. No significant increase in CPT was observed in the presence of 0.0001 and 0.001 M molybdate. However, addition of 0.01 M MoO42- increases 10 °C in CPT and pitting corrosion was not observed in solution containing 0.1 M molybdate up to 85 °C. Potentiostatic CPT measurements showed CPT values of 68 and more than 85 °C in 0.01 and 0.1 M molybdate concentrations, respectively.
